Cotton-Seed Linter

Description: Patent for an improvement "to prevent the accumulation of lint within the lint-chambers; to provide for the automatic discharge of the lint from the saw-teeth; to provide for a thorough agitation of the seed within the seed-reviews, and, finally, to provide for the delivery of the stripped seed from the machine" (lines 12-19).
Date: August 5, 1890
Creator: O'Brien, Edward J.

Chopping-Ax.

Description: Patent for an ax that is "provided with a poll made in two sections adapted to be clamped or secured to the handle and receive a removable bit or hardened section presenting the cutting edge" (lines 16-20).
Date: January 5, 1897
Creator: Crabtree, James G.
